Savannas are typically associated with a tropical wet-dry climate. This climate features a distinct dry season lasting several months, followed by a wet season with heavy rainfall. Savannas have a well-defined dry period that allows grasses and some trees to thrive, making them ideal for this ecosystem.

Dry! A desert is defined as a region that receives less than 10 inches (250 mm) of annual precipitation on average.
The five main climate zones are tropical, dry, mild, snowy, polar. These are defined by temperature and humidity. Tropical climates fairly rainy.
